Can I expense unspent rental condo reserve fund upon sale?

Did not capitalize or expense it as fund was not spent. CRA says it is a prepaid expense & cannot be deducted until it is spent. What do I do now that the condo has sold? CRA agent said add it to Adjusted Cost Base but not to T776. I already have a capital loss so that's no help.

Can I expense unspent rental condo reserve fund upon sale?

According to the CRA rules, if the expense isn’t considered to be “current” which appears to be the case, it must be capitalized. It’s not “lost”.  It will just increase the capital loss-which can be carried forward if there’s no capital gains to use it against this year or carried back to apply to previous losses.
